3 SIBLINGS CHARGED AFTER AN 18-YEAR-OLD WAS FOUND TIED TO A BED AND DIED FROM STARVATION. (PHOTO).


 3 siblings charged after an 18-year-old Cedar Rapids, Iowa man was found tied to a bed and deceased from starvation. 


Police in Cedar Rapids were called to the report of a deceased individual on November 9th, 2024. When authorities arrived on the scene they discovered 18-year-old Ezekiel Baseme, deceased.  


According to family members, Ezekiel was suffering from a severe mental break a few days earlier. The family claimed Ezekiel had not been eating or sleeping. They said "he had been acting aggressively towards them and they were worried he might harm someone else or himself, so two of his brothers were forced to tie him down to a mattress".


The brothers said they kept watch over him and when they offered him food or water he would become aggressive again. The brothers claimed at some point while checking on Ezekiel they realized he was stiff and cold to the touch. After finding their brother obviously deceased the siblings waited a day before notifying authorities. 


After an extensive investigation into the matter, the state medical examiner announced that Ezekial had passed away as a result of dehydration and probable starvation in a setting of physical restraint.


As a result of the findings during the investigation, police have announced the arrest of three of Ezekiel's siblings. 23-year-old Azane Baseme, 29-year-old Christian Baseme and 26-year-old Pierre Baseme are being charged with involuntary manslaughter, false imprisonment and assault causing bodily injury.
